News at glanceLatestPoliticsWeb SpecialWorldState ScanSportsCricketBusinessEntertainmentTechnologyDiasporaColumnsReal EstateMatrimonialAutomotiveHome NewsDiasporaFull Story News Friday,14 March 2008 12:54 hrs ISTH-1B visas creating jobs in US: study ...


Recent comments
5 years 36 weeks ago
15 years 3 days ago
15 years 1 week ago
15 years 1 week ago
15 years 18 weeks ago
15 years 18 weeks ago
15 years 25 weeks ago
15 years 43 weeks ago
16 years 25 weeks ago
16 years 25 weeks ago